Went thru all three Windows XP Service Packs, Vista's 2 Service Packs, Windows 7 Service Pack 1 and never had so much stuff broke as when I upgraded Windows 8 to 8.1 Preview this morning.  I'm 100% with you, compusurf.  Microsoft just doesn't get it.  Well... they do "get it" but, they're bound and determined to stay the course on their Metro strategy flowing across all devices from phones, tablets to PC's.  I'm a 30 year veteran IT professional and the one-size fits all mentality does NOT work when running Windows 8 on a desktop.  I've setup close to 30 desktop PC's/Laptops in the past 6 months for new Windows 8 users and not a one of them took a liking to the Metro-style interface.  Those are the everyday users of Windows whose word-of-mouth advertising for Microsoft is giving Windows 8 a bad name!  As soon as I install Start8 on these users' machines, they're happy again.  There you go, Microsoft... you can't argue with success.
